I have a question: Sometimes you say not to undermine/fortify over the threshold and any more would be a waste- but what happens if we continue to push the system up as stated above regarding Tricorii? Does going over the threshold help in certain instances?
 
Well when you undermine control systems every merit beyond the 100% trigger is just wasted (the same for fortification), they don't do any more damage. Also a system that's not fully undermined has no higher CC costs at all (so if a system has undermining merits in it but not enough to reach the 100% trigger those don't do anything too).

Expansions (like Tricorii last cycle) are different. In those the side with the highest total percentage wins, i.e. in our expansion Ravas we have 6518% worth of own merits (to expand) and 224% merits worth of opposition. If someone wanted to oppose that expansion diretly they would have to do another 6300%. So in a control system you can simply stop after reaching the undermining trigger, but expansions have ongoing contest over the whole cycle and the highest percentage wins.
 
Ok, so expansions are based upon whomever has the highest amount of merits and control systems are based upon whomever reaches the trigger first.. correct?
 
Nearly. Expansions the highest percentage wins. In control systems reaching fort and undermining triggers influences the upkeep costs. Both triggers can be reached in a cycle (i.e. if a system is undermined it can still be fortified and it won't matter what happened first).

The different cost states:
Not fortified & not undermined: Default upkeep costs
Fortified & undermined: Default upkeep costs (cancel each other out)
Fortifed & not undermined: Zero Upkeep costs
Not fortified & undermined: Default upkeep costs + system income is lost (for the cycle)
